Luizinho Drummond
Luiz Pacheco Drummond (14 February 1940 — 1 July 2020), nicknamed Luizinho Drummond, was a Brazilian illegal lottery operator. He was the patron of samba school Imperatriz Leopoldinense. He was the president of the Independent League of Samba Schools of Rio de Janeiro (LIESA) from 1998 to 2001.

Drummond died on 1 July 2020 from a stroke in Rio de Janeiro, aged 80.[1]
